Hydrogenation of Glucose over Ru Nanoparticles Embedded in Templated Porous Carbon

Jiajia Liu A, Xiao Ning Tian A, Xiu Song Zhao A B

A Department of Chemical and Biomolecular Engineering, National University of Singapore, 4 Engineering Drive 4, 117576, Singapore.
B Corresponding author. Email: chezxs@nus.edu.sg
 
PDF (559 KB) $25
 Supplementary Material
 Export Citation
 Print
  


Abstract

Ruthenium (Ru) nanoparticles incorporated into the pore walls of porous carbon was used as a catalyst in glucose hydrogenation to produce sorbitol. In comparison with other catalysts, including commercial catalysts and catalysts prepared using other methods, the Ru-C nanostructured catalyst displayed higher catalytic activity and stability. These effects were associated with the enhanced contact between the Ru nanoparticles and carbon matrix, as well as the unblocked pores of the catalyst.
